Eric Raymond:

Added and documented the capability for shlex to handle lexical-level
inclusion and a stack of input sources.  Also, the input stream member
is now documented, and the constructor takes an optional source-filename.
The class provides facilities to generate error messages that track
file and line number.

[GvR: I changed the __main__ code so that it actually stops at EOF, as
Eric surely intended -- however it returned '' instead of the None he
was testing for.]
